Giant monopole resonance strength in40Ca

Abstract
The giant resonance region in 40Ca was studied with inelastic scattering of 240 MeV α particles at small angles including 0°. A peak at Ex=17.5±0.4MeV with Γ=4.95±0.25MeV was found to contain 33±4% of the isoscalar E0 energy-weighted-sum-rule (EWSR) strength and 57±6% of the isoscalar E2 EWSR. Evidence was found for 92±15% of the isoscalar E0 EWSR between 8<Ex<29MeV with a centroid of 18.9±0.4MeV and a rms half width of 11.1 MeV but a definitive L=0 assignment could not be made. The resulting EGMR is in agreement with systematics from heavier nuclei.
